THEmounster

THEmounster

Views:
971,862
Subscribers:
325
Videos:
201
Duration:
6:23:46

THEmounster is a YouTube channel which has 325 subscribers, with his content totaling over 971.86 thousand views views across 201 videos.

Created on ● Channel Link: https://www.youtube.com/channel/UCQ4Awe1p_bZoIvhRhtMw8hg